The Orange Rocker 15 Terror Amp Head packs 15 watts of authentic valve power into a compact, rugged metal chassis. Featuring twin channels with full EQ, a valve-buffered effects loop, and versatile power modes including a bedroom attenuator, it’s engineered for musicians who demand iconic Orange tone and flexible volume control for both home and live use.

Expensive but Worth It.
This amp is ideal for use while recording in a home studio or while playing small venue gigs. The half /full power switch accompanied with the headroom/bedroom switch allow you to push the amp and get a full range of sound with out getting too loud in the bedroom setting while also being able to get plenty of volume to play live while in the full power mode. This amps controls are also very basic making it very easy to use and the amp supports pedals very will in both the natural (clean) and dirty (distorted) channel.

Great Amp for home use, it's not a 2 channel OR15.
I bought this from Sweetwater hoping it would be a 2 channel OR15 with an attenuator. It is not. For studio use the OR15 is the way to go, the tone is amazing with quality tubes and a/b-ing the amps, the terror cant touch the OR15 at loud volumes. This Terror 15 is really good on clean but the crunch is more fuzzy than than the OR15 but still good, just different. The distortion on the terror has far less ( more like none) hiss and buzz than the OR15. What makes this a 5 star review is the headroom / bedroom switch. I can get fantastic tone with the terror at very low volumes at home and this might be why some recommend it for studio use. The OR15 doesnt do high distortion low volume very well at all especially with the Orange 212s with high efficiency speakers. The OR15 cranked is the best I've played in 25 years. So, I use an ABY and run both of these amps together except when playing low volumes at home. The clean on the terror takes pedals well but i need a treble boost on it with humbuckers to get any bright cleans out of it.
